8-2. Current Control

The operating current may rise as a result of causes
including increasing heating or cooling loads or
decreases in power voltage. In these cases, the
operating frequency is automatically reduced, or
operation is stopped, in order to control the operating
current so that it is 20 A or less.
As a result:
• Power breakers and fuses will not be tripped.
• Operation can continue during this period with
somewhat reduced heating or cooling capacity.
• Operation at normal capacity is restored when the
cause of the current rise is eliminated.

• Operates at the target frequency at Point A and below.
• Stops increases to the frequency between Points A and B.
• Reduces the frequency by 1 Hz per 0.5 seconds when Point B is exceeded.
• Stops operation, and restarts it approximately 3 minutes later, if Point C is
exceeded.
(May operate when sudden voltage fluctuations occur. → Indicates trouble.)

8-3. Low Start Current

Operation starts at 10 Hz, and the start current is less than
the normal operating current. This prevents the flickering of
fluorescent lights or television screens that occurs when
ordinary A/C units start.

8-4. Compressor Temperature Control

To protect the compressor coil from overheating, the
operating frequency is controlled based on the compressor
discharge temperature.
